Specifications

  • Architecture: 16-bit CISC
  • CPU Frequency: Up to 32 MHz
  • Flash Memory: 128 KB
  • RAM: 8 KB
  • Operating Voltage: 2.7 V to 5.5 V
  • I/O Ports: 34
  • Timers/Counters: 4
  • Analog-to-Digital Converter (ADC): 10-bit, 8 channels
  • Serial Communication Interfaces: UART, I2C, SPI
  •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to +85°C
